Bridgwater and West Somerset MP wrong on energy production - Butt Philip

12.00.00pm BST (GMT +0100) Wed 14th Oct 2009

Following Ian Liddell-Grainger's debate on energy production in Westminster Hall yesterday, Theo Butt Philip said:

"I was disappointed when I read the text of Mr Liddell-Grainger's speech in Westminster Hall today.

"There are many energy production issues facing the Bridgwater and West Somerset and the United Kingdom as a whole.

"Having secured a debate, supposedly on energy production, Mr Liddell-Grainger chose to focus on the narrow issue of nuclear power.

"Nuclear power is hugely expensive. Reactors cost millions to build and it then costs millions to clean up their waste.

"By the time the new generation of nuclear plants come on line, we could have invested the money in energy efficiency and renewable energy projects so we wouldn't even need them.
